Zusammenfassung
Löscht die angegebene Version aus der Eingabe-Enterprise, -Workgroup- oder -Desktop-Geodatabase.
Verwendung
Die Version kann nur vom Besitzer der Version gelöscht werden.
Eine Parent-Version kann erst gelöscht werden, nachdem alle abhängigen Child-Versionen gelöscht wurden.
Versionen sind von Änderungen in anderen Versionen der Geodatabase nicht betroffen.
Werkzeuge zur Versionierung funktionieren nur mit Daten einer Enterprise-, Workgroup- und Desktop-Geodatabase. File- und Personal-Geodatabases unterstützen keine Versionierung.
Syntax
DeleteVersion(in_workspace, version_name)
Parameter | Erklärung | Datentyp |
in_workspace | Gibt die Datenbankverbindungsdatei für die Enterprise-, Workgroup- oder Desktop-Geodatabase an, in der die zu löschende Version enthalten ist. Standardmäßig wird der Workspace verwendet, der in der Umgebung für den aktuellen Workspace definiert ist. | Workspace |
version_name | Gibt den Namen der zu löschenden Version an. | String |
Abgeleitete Ausgabe
Name | Erklärung | Datentyp |
out_workspace | Der aktualisierte Eingabe-Workspace. | Workspace |
Codebeispiel
DeleteVersion – Beispiel (eigenständiges Skript)
Mit dem folgenden eigenständigen Skript wird veranschaulicht, wie Sie das Werkzeug DeleteVersion zum Löschen einer Version verwenden.
# Description: Deletes a version
# Import system modules
import arcpy
# Set local variables
inWorkspace = "c:/Connections/whistler@gdb.sde"
versionName = "myVersion2"
# Execute DeleteVersion
arcpy.DeleteVersion_management(inWorkspace, versionName)
Umgebungen
Lizenzinformationen
- Basic: Nein
- Standard: Ja
- Advanced: Ja